Output 862dab9503fefb78a0add363611dc78fd614faeb3b64816fd888e253d5df3409:2

value
35547938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fa752181be63fcd39d421e1e0c5553f73c0f07e OP_EQUAL
address
MKY8VSKSx2XXt64eLXe6SpJbGv7wtHPnSR
transaction
862dab9503fefb78a0add363611dc78fd614faeb3b64816fd888e253d5df3409
spent
true